Yes, when I go back to pick the trailer after the service the last thing I do will go over the load equalizer hitch setup process. I just ordered a tongue weight scale to ensure that I do not have the load of the trailer too far forward. I figure the scale is a cheap investment and will go a long way toward preventing unnecessary repair bills.

Just a quick update, I have installed the rubber overload springs, OEM trailer brake controller, and OEM extendable towing mirrors. The RV center that I am bringing the trailer to was booked solid until Nov. 24 so between now and the appointment I will finish cleaning and setting up the trailer the way I feel will be most comfortable once I hit the road. I also picked up a used LEER 6.5ft fiberglass cap for the back of the truck and put all new gaskets to seal to the pickup bed. Once the trailer is serviced and all my legal matters are settled I expect to be hitting the road with my little buddy Dudley.
